The Rolls-Royce Silver Shadow II is a 4/5 seater sedan/saloon by Rolls-Royce, producing 189 bhp, and 530 Nm of torque, with a 0-100 km/h time of 9.9 seconds, and a top speed of 203 km/h, Valued at approximately £35,000.
Overview
The interesting thing about this car in a 600-car catalogue is where it sits away from the usual performance conversation: the Rolls-Royce Silver Shadow II ranks 581st for power and 598th for 0-100 km/h acceleration. Those numbers place it near the opposite end of the performance scale, yet that is exactly what makes its position in a dream garage distinct. This is a luxury sedan where presence, scale and mechanical character matter more than chasing the quickest figures.
Its 189 bhp from a naturally aspirated 6.8-litre V8 and 530 Nm of torque explain the relaxed approach. The Silver Shadow II uses rear-wheel drive and reaches 100 km/h in 9.9 seconds, with a top speed of 203 km/h. Against the full catalogue, those figures place it near the back for acceleration and top speed, but the comparison also shows how unusual it is to find a car with this specification. Of the 600 cars, 216 use a V8 layout, 132 combine a V8 with rear-wheel drive, and just 56 are naturally aspirated V8 cars. The Silver Shadow II occupies a narrow space within that group, pairing a large naturally aspirated V8 with a four or five seater saloon format.

Specifications
Engine
6.75L V8 naturally aspirated
Displacement
6.8L
Power
189 bhp
Torque
530 Nm
0-100 km/h
9.9s
Top Speed
203 km/h
Drivetrain
RWD
Country
UK
Body Style
4/5 seater sedan/saloon
Years
1977–1980
Production
8,425
Price Used
£35,000
